December 11, 2019 NHTSA CAMPAIGN NUMBER: 19V882000
10A Circuit Breaker Can Trip Causing Stall
An engine stall increases the risk of a crash.
NHTSA Campaign Number: 19V882
Manufacturer Indian Motorcycle Company
Components 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
Potential Number of Units Affected 5,474
Summary
Indian Motorcycle Company (Indian
) is recalling certain 2019 Chieftain, Vintage, Roadmaster
, Dark Horse, Springfield, and FTR1200 motorcycles. A 10A circuit breaker may be defective, tripping unexpectedly and causing a sudden loss of power and an engine stall.
Remedy
Indian will notify owners and provide a new 10A circuit breaker and installation instructions. Owners may choose to have the part installed at a dealership, free of charge. The recall began January 22, 2020. Owners may contact Indian
customer service at 1-877-204-3697. Indian
’s number for this recall is I-19-05.
Notes
Owners may also contact the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(TTY 1-800-424-9153), or go to www.safercar.gov.

REPAIR PROCEDURE
TOOLS REQUIRED:
- Ratchet
- 6mm Allen
1. Place the motorcycle on flat surface on side stand.
2. Place transmission in Neutral.
3. Power off motorcycle and turn STOP / RUN switch to STOP position.
4. Remove the key from the ignition.
IMPORTANT |
Before proceeding, ensure the transmission is in Neutral, the motorcycle STOP / RUN switch is in the STOP position, and the key has been removed from the ignition. |
5. Remove the right-hand v-cover q by removing the three fasteners w using 6mm allen.
NOTICE |
Note v-cover orientation during removal. |
7. Identify the three 10A breakers r (marked FAN 10A, ENGINE 10A, and IGNITION 10A on the fusebox cover legend).
8. Remove three 10A breakers and discard.
9. Verify replacement breaker has red paint dot on it.
10.Install three replacement 10A breakers.
11. Install fusebox cover.
IMPORTANT |
Listen for audible click during cover installation. |
12.Install right-hand v-cover and align mounting holes.
13.Install three fasteners and torque to specification.
TORQUE |
V-cover Fastener: 36 in-lbs (4 Nยทm) |
14. Insert key and turn to the โonโ position but do not start the engine. Check the function of vehicle lighting and gauges. Start the engine to ensure normal operation and that no warning lights are present in cluster.

2019 10A Circuit Breaker Safety Bulletin FAQ
Version: R01 (December 12, 2019)
What is the purpose of the I-19-05 / T-19-02 Safety Bulletin?
Polaris has identified some 2019 Indian
(111 c.i. and FTR) Motorcycles and Polaris
Slingshots may have 10A circuit breakers that do not meet quality standards. Affected circuit breakers do not meet functional specifications and may cause an engine to unexpectedly stop running, increasing the risk of a crash. To address this concern, Polaris
is instructing dealers to replace the 10A circuit breaker installed in affected vehicles, as outlined in the repair instructions.
What make & model years are included in this bulletin?
2019 Indian Motorcycle Chief, Springfield, Chieftain, Roadmaster
, and FTR, along with 2019 Polaris
Slingshot models built from 2/12/2019 through 7/31/2019.
How can a dealer see which units in inventory are impacted by this?
- Login to the dealer website (DEX).
- Locate the โService and Warrantyโ dropdown, click on STOP Site.
- On the left-hand side of the page, under โSTOP Site Links,โ click on โService Bulletinsโ.
- Locate the link for the bulletin of interest and click on the โAll VINsโ link located on the right.
- The โAll VINsโ page will display all affected VINs within your dealershipโs inventory.
NOTE: Unit Inquiry can always be used to check an individual VIN.
Is this a STOP SALE and a STOP RIDE?
This is a STOP SALE until wholegood stock vehicles are updated as needed. This is NOT a STOP RIDE for consumers.

What parts are required to update the vehicles affected by this bulletin, and will dealers need to order them? Part Number 4011371 BREAKER-CIRCUIT,10 AMP is required to perform this update, and will need to be ordered. Note that quantities required to update one VIN vary by vehicle:
- Indian
Motorcycle 111 c.i.: 1 circuit breaker
- Indian
Motorcycle FTR: 3 circuit breakers
- Slingshot: 2 circuit breakers
Bulletin Part Number 4011371 is the same as the part number for circuit breakers in dealerโs service parts inventory. How does a dealer know if theyโre using a good circuit breaker?
Any circuit breaker in service parts inventory without a red paint dot should NOT be used. Reference the bulletin document for photos and information to help locate the paint markings.
What if parts are showing on backorder or not available?
Dealers should still place orders for the quantities required. Itโs important to get all orders entered into the system so Polaris can track demand and keep parts flowing to dealers.
Do any parts need to be returned as part of this bulletin?
Circuit breakers removed from vehicles do not need to be returned. However, any circuit breaker in service parts inventory without a red paint dot will need to be returned. Reference the bulletin document to file a part stock warranty claim for these parts.
Are the parts returnable if a dealer over orders?
No. Our standard RMA policy excludes the return of Service or Safety Bulletin parts.
How does a dealer know if/when theyโre receiving parts?
Follow this path: DEX Homepage -> PG&A -> Purchase Order Inquiry. Once there, follow these steps:
Will Dealers have all of the appropriate tools to complete this bulletin?
Yes. No tools are required to perform the Slingshot or 111 c.i. bulletin. FTR requires a ratchet and 6mm Allen.
